The purpose of this study is to describe the safety profile of durvalumab in combination with platinum-based chemotherapy followed by durvalumab with olaparib as first-line treatment for patients with pMMR advanced or recurrent endometrial cancer. Study population: Approximately 85 eligible patients with newly diagnosed pMMR advanced or recurrent endometrial cancer (aEC) will be enrolled into the study distributed in approximately 20 sites in Spain. Study details include: * The recruitment period will be approximately 12 months. * The study duration will be approximately 48 months (12 months recruitment period + 36 months treatment and follow-up). * The median treatment duration will be approximately 13 months based on treatment duration for durvalumab + olaparib in DUO-E (22) (until objective radiological disease progression, unacceptable toxicity, consent withdrawal or death). Those patients in complete response will be allowed to discontinue durvalumab plus olaparib after completing 2 years in the maintenance phase. * The analysis for the primary objective is planned to be conducted 12 months after LSI to allow all patients have had the opportunity for 12 months of follow up, and at the end of the follow-up of the last patient up to 36 months. * The visit frequency will be: oChemotherapy Phase: every 21 days (every cycle). oMaintenance Phase: every 28 days (every cycle) Treatment: * Durvalumab + Chemotherapy phase: Durvalumab (IV) with SoC (carboplatin + paclitaxel chemotherapy: patients should receive at least 4, but preferably 6 cycles) every three weeks. * Durvalumab + Olaparib phase: durvalumab (IV) with olaparib (tablets) every four weeks until progression.
